Cost Of Living In Ephrata, WA Summary

Cost of living in Ephrata research summary. The cost of living index is set to 100 for the average place in the United States. A cost of living index above 100 means Ephrata is expensive. An index value below 100 means the city is a relatively cheap place to live.

On a city-by-city basis in Washington, home prices and rent have the biggest impact on the cost of living. Here are the key takeaways based on Saturday Night Science:

  • The cost of living index in Ephrata is 98, with 100 being the average.

  • The cost of living index in Ephrata is 1.0x lower than the national average.

  • Ephrata ranks as the #8 cheapest in Washington out of 192.

  • Ephrata ranks as the #2,372 cheapest out of 6,489 in the US.

  • The median home value in Ephrata is $323,272.

  • The median income in Ephrata is $70,321.

What is the cost of living in Ephrata, WA?

According to the most recent data on the cost of living, Ephrata has an overall cost of living index of 98, which is 1.0x lower than the national index of 100.

Compared to Washington, Ephrata has a cost of living index that's 0.8x lower than Washington's index of 118.

The standard of living in Ephrata ranks as #8 most affordable out of the 192 places we measured in Washington. By definition, that implies Ephrata ranks as the #184 most expensive place in the Evergreen State.

Ephrata Cost Of Living Vs. Washington

Six factors go into calculating the cost of living index in Ephrata. Here is how it fairs on each of the criteria:

  • The Services index in Ephrata is 104.

  • The Groceries index in Ephrata is 108.

  • The Health index in Ephrata is 118.

  • The Housing index in Ephrata is 89.

  • The Transportation index in Ephrata is 125.

  • The Utilities index in Ephrata is 77.

Living Expense Ephrata Washington National Average
Overall 98 118 100
Services 104 111 100
Groceries 108 112 100
Health 118 122 100
Housing 89 135 100
Transportation 125 124 100
Utilities 77 91 100

Ephrata, WA Housing Cost Breakdown

Housing swings affordability the most between places in Washington, so we broke down housing costs into more detail. Home and income data comes from the most recent US Census ACS 2019-2023. The key points are:

  • The Median Home Value in Ephrata is $323,272.

  • The Median Rent in Ephrata is $993.

  • The Median Income in Ephrata is $70,321.

  • The Home Value To Income in Ephrata is 4.6x.

  • The Rent To Monthly Income in Ephrata is 0.17x.

Statistic Ephrata Washington United States
Median Home Value $323,272 $595,737 $303,400
Median Rent $993 $1,682 $1,348
Median Income $70,321 $94,952 $78,538
Home Value To Income 4.6x 6.3x 3.9x
Rent To Monthly Income 0.17x 0.21x 0.21x
